|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
轮性能微软曾做过一个例子,就是同一个项目用java和.net来作,结果开发周期,.net是java的一半,性能java是.net的十分之一,代码量java是.net的三倍。呵呵,这说明了什么,.net的全方位比java好。但是有的人说.net不能跨平台,这个问题我和我同学曾讨论过,都认为微软的.net很可能早都可以跨平台了,但是微软为了保护他们的操作系统,所以才没有推出跨平台的.net,只是推出了跨语言的.net,web|xmlstruts使用程序的设置:
上篇文章讲了controller,可是我发明关于JakartaStruts中的别的内容已忘记殆尽,前人云:温故而知新,就让我对前边几章作一下温习
这里要设置的文件有两个,一个是web.xml,另外一个是struts-config.xml
1、为struts设置web.xml
1,设置ActionServlet(onlyone),使其吸收使用程序收到的一切哀求
分为两步,a:利用servlet元素设置servlet实例,做servlet-mapping
<web-app>
<servlet>
<servlet-name>storefront</servlet-name>
<servlet-class>完整限制的类名</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>storefront</servlet-name>
<url-pattern>*.do</url-pattern>
</servlet-mapping>
</web-map>
2,设置初始化参数:init-param,以name/value暗示<param-name><param-value>
config:默许为/WEB-INF/struts-config.xml
config/sub1:config/...从附加的struts设置文件中加在资程序sub1
debug:servlet的调试detail
detail:Digester的调试detail
convertHack
3,<taglib>利用struts供应的标志库时必需设置包含
<taglib-uri>辨认web使用程序所利用的标志库,必需是无效的
<taglib-location>指定了标志库形貌文件的地位
4,<welcome-file-list>设置在webapp中输出无效的,但不完全的url所利用的defaultresource;不利用servlet映照
<welcome-file>肇端和停止都没有/标记
5,<error-page>
(<error-code><location>)
<<exception-type><location>
</error-page>
2、Struts设置文件
ApplicationConfig:包括了struts设置文件中的一切信息
1,<data-source>
<set-propertyproperty=““value=““/>
<data-source>
2,<form-beans>
<form-beanname=“loginForm“type=“完整限制的类名,是ActionForm的子类“>
<form-propertyname=““type=““/>
</form-bean>
<form-bean
</form-beans>
3,<global-exceptions>
4,<global-forwards>
作者Blog:http://blog.csdn.net/wjsfr/
那这个对象有什么意义?现在很多用javabean的人就不能保证对象有完整的意义,不成熟的使用模式等导致代码疯狂增长,调试维护的时间要得多得多。在说性能之前,先说说你这个比较的来历。据说微软为了证明。net比java好。 |
|